Flood Warning until 04:00AM Friday

...The National Weather Service in Topeka KS has issued a Flood Warning for the following rivers in Kansas... Smoky Hill River at Enterprise affecting Dickinson County.

* WHAT...Minor flooding is forecast.

* WHERE...Smoky Hill River at Enterprise.

* WHEN...From late tonight to early Friday morning.

* IMPACTS...At 21.0 feet, Low land agricultural flooding occurs from near Enterprise to near Junction City. At 26.0 feet, Valley north of the Kansas Highway 43 bridge on the north side of Enterprise floods. At 27.0 feet, Railroad tracks near Enterprise flood.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 8:45 PM CDT Wednesday the stage was 24.7 feet. - Forecast...The river is expected to rise above flood stage just after midnight tonight to a crest of 26.6 feet tomorrow morning. It will then fall below flood stage late tomorrow afternoon. - Flood stage is 26.0 feet.

* AFFECTED AREAS: DICKINSON, KS

Instructions:

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ood deaths occur in vehicles. Motorists should not attempt to drive around barricades or drive cars through flooded areas. This product along with additional weather and stream information is available at www.weather.gov/top/.
